There are no claims under the ŠKODA Warranty if vehicle dam-
age has occurred in causal connection with one of the following
circumstances:
The service work was not carried out on time and professio-
nally according to the provisions of ŠKODA AUTO, or its exe-
cution was not proven by the customer when asserting claims
under the ŠKODA Warranty.
Damage has not been reported immediately to a specialist
company or has not been properly remedied.
Damage refers to parts that are subject to natural wear, such
as tyres, spark plugs, wiper blades, brake pads and brake discs,
clutch, bulbs, synchronizer rings, batteries, etc.
External impact or influences (e.g. accident, hail, flood, fire
etc.).
Installation, connection of parts or accessories, other adapta-
tion or technical modification of the vehicle not approved by
ŠKODA AUTO (e.g. Tuning).
Unauthorized use, improper handling (e.g. use in motor sport
competitions or overloading), improper care or unauthorized
maintenance.
Non-observance of instructions in the Owner's Manual or in
other factory instructions, including, but not limited to, non-
observance of instructions regarding the procedure for charg-
ing the high-voltage battery.
Use of the vehicle as a stationary source of electrical energy or
extraction and subsequent use of the high-voltage battery
outside the vehicle.
Exposure of the high-voltage battery to water or other liquids.
The customer shall prove the lack of causation.

ŠKODA Mobility warranty
The Mobility Warranty provides you with a sense of certainty for
journeys in your vehicle.
If your vehicle is left on the road due to an unexpected fault, we
can provide services to keep you moving as part of the mobility
guarantee, including the following: technical assistance on the
phone, breakdown assistance at the breakdown location, start-
up on site, and towing to the ŠKODA service partner, if necessa-
ry.
If your vehicle is not repaired on the same day, then the ŠKODA
Service Partner may, if necessary, arrange additional subsequent
services, such as replacement transport (bus, train, etc.), the pro-
vision of a replacement vehicle, and the like.
Specific claims for free provision of services under the ŠKODA
Mobility Warranty only exist if your vehicle has remained in a
causal connection with a defect which is to be remedied on the
basis of fulfilment under the ŠKODA Warranty.
Check the conditions for provision of the Mobility Warranty for
your vehicle with your ŠKODA Partner. They will also inform you
of the detailed terms and conditions of the Mobility Warranty in
relation to your vehicle. In the event that your vehicle is not cov-
ered by a mobility warranty, he will inform you of the possibili-
ties for subsequent conclusion.
Optional ŠKODA Extended Warranty
If you also purchased a ŠKODA Extended Warranty when pur-
chasing your new car, ŠKODA AUTO will provide you with a free
repair of vehicle damage caused by a defect in the vehicle during
the warranty period.
